Captain Sir Tom Moore spoke about how he "nearly died" after suffering a painful fall last year.The 100-year-old former British Army officer is known for raising £38.9m pounds for charity in the run-up to his 100th birthday during the COVID-19 pandemic.He made headlines for his record-breaking charity walks, which led him to being knighted by the Queen.However, Sir Tom "nearly didn't make 100" as he suffered a painful accident last year.He discussed the scary ordeal while being interviewed on Piers Morgan's Life Stories.His family explained how he "collided backwards into the dishwasher", and "shattered his hip and broke a rib."Pictures showed Tom in hospital, his face completely swollen after he "punctured a lung".One of Tom's daughters.
